Output a85de8c01badd26278457926751fa706bdf5af345c5ea010a0ca80988cd72ace:151

value
381471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c325482482eaabc2d5b18b0103fc1f71f051edc OP_EQUAL
address
35ihwyuBdQz9YiGputbqrdGGxSfpo6DLkQ
transaction
a85de8c01badd26278457926751fa706bdf5af345c5ea010a0ca80988cd72ace
confirmations
116058
spent
true